Old Town San Diego Parking

In the next couple of months, California will be facilitating a feasibility study for Old Town State Park in San Diego. The study relates to the Parking Management Plan and the results of the plan may impact the surrounding neighborhoods including Mission Hills. For example, how would any new paid parking system impact the surrounding residential areas? Would we see an increase in overflow parking? In regards to Mission Hills, my answer is probably not. One major appeal of the Mission Hills Community is the proximity to Old Town. However, the steep topography buffers the neighborhood from a lot of commercial and visitor foot traffic. That said, implementing the paid parking system will certainly impact both the local residents as well as the business in Old Town which now benefit from free parking throughout Old Town. More information on the feasibility study can be provided by the Old Town San Diego Chamber of Commerce or from District 2 Council Member Kevin Faulconer.
